RTK vs LiDAR: Which Technology Fits Your Yard?

Key Advantages

  • RTK: Ideal for open lawns with clear sky visibility.
  • LiDAR: Better suited for enclosed yards with trees, walls, and obstacles.

Buying Caution

Neither technology is universally better. The layout and conditions of your yard will determine the best fit.

How It Compares

The HOOKII Neomow X2’s LiDAR-first approach makes it a versatile choice for complex yards, while RTK-based mowers like Segway Navimow shine in open spaces.

How does RTK compare to LiDAR in robotic lawn mowers?

RTK is better for open lawns with clear sky visibility, while LiDAR excels in enclosed yards with obstacles and trees.
